My future
A few years ago
when I was in 8th
grade, I worried
a lot about my
future.
Every
day, I thought
'What am I going
to do when I
leave school?'.
I didn't feel
excited about
the future - I just
felt very scared. One reason was that at that
time I found school difficult. I usually studied
hard and listened in class (well, I thought
so), but my teachers never seemed to be
very happy with my work - or with me. When
I think back to those times now, I remember
that sometimes I didn't concentrate very well
and I also handed in work too late. This went
on for most of the year, but then near the end

of the year something happened. I suddenly
knew what my dream job was. I love animals
and I decided that I wanted to become a vet!
To do that I had to go to a good university. And
to go to a good university, I had to get good
marks and do well in my exams.
From 9th grade onwards, I worked very hard
every day in class. I studied for hours at home
and my parents even told me to work less!
At the end of that year, I won a prize for my
good marks. My family were so proud of me
and I felt great. But then, I started to worry
again. I thought 'What will happen if I don't
get good results next year?' and 'If I didn't go
to university, what would I do?'. Everyone told
me that I just had to do my best and to stop
worrying. So that's exactly what I did!
I often think back to 8th grade when I was so
scared. Now I feel much more confident and
I'm looking forward to the future!
